Default Different gear ratios in a MT car

Has anyone considered changing the gear ratios in a MT car. I wonder if they can be adjusted closer to the ones in a GT3. This may make the car more lively. In a Powerkit car the effect would be even more noticeable. The combination could make for a less flashy alternative to a GT3.

Of course they can be changed. PDK too for that matter, although in that case it wouldn't surprise if the factory had to do it. Lots of places stateside could change ratios in a 991 gear box. Nobody ever does stuff like this though. They'll spend a thousands on fiberglass, wheels and coffee can mufflers before putting hundreds into gears that will really make the car move. Because the thing is, the car already moves just fine.

I re geared my RS
Changed ring and pinion and first thru fourth gears
Far more "usable" than a car geared to 190+ mph
It's not difficult but does cost
